Break-glass access: SquatWatch

Quick notes for the weekly sync. SquatWatch is our typo-squatting package scanner; if it goes dark, malicious lookalike packages can slip into the Pellbrook registry, so we keep a break-glass path. Use it only when both regular admins are unreachable and the scanner has been down 30+ minutes. Grab the sealed envelope from the ops locker, log the incident in #squatwatch-alerts, and ping whoever's on call. The break-glass login prompts for the passphrase below.

unlock words, tagaf-tawif: quenys-zordor-aldius-caswyn

This step replaces the legacy fixture loader with the Fabrikell test-data factory library across the CI test suite. On-call should run this during a quiet window: the factory seeds deterministic records into the ephemeral test database, and any in-flight pipeline runs using old fixtures will fail with schema mismatches. Drain the queue first, then deploy the updated test image. If seeding hangs, check connection pool limits before retrying — do not re-seed twice. Configure the factory service with the following values.

service settings:
[oliix]
team = noveth
access_code = ac_4de949
host = oliix.novachq.corp
port = 8080
owner = wenir.casion
peer = wenys.lumicstack.corp

Provenance notes: BounceBroom (our email bounce processor). Quick heads-up for reviewers — every merged PR produces a signed artifact, and the deploy bot refuses anything without an attestation. So if you're reviewing the retry-classifier change, don't eyeball the container tag; check the attestation chain instead. The artifact you should be reviewing corresponds to the token below.

session token of kafop-hawep = htk21_413e49a27bdeacde54774

Team — DR drill Friday for the Nettlecote backfill scheduler. We'll kill the primary at 02:00 and confirm nightly backfills resume on the standby within 15 minutes. New folks: just observe and take notes. Restarting the scheduler's credential store on the standby requires the recovery passphrase given below.

strongbox words: sorir-belvan-rusix-ulays-ralmir-praix-eliir-tamax-praael-druael-julir-tamius-jorir